Traveling from Brussels to Saarbrücken offers several convenient transportation options. The quickest way is by train, taking about 3 to 4 hours, with regular services available that connect via Luxembourg or other cities. Buses are a more economical choice, with travel times ranging from 4 to 6 hours, making them suitable for budget travelers. For those who prefer flexibility, driving takes approximately 3 hours, allowing for scenic stops along the way. Flights are less practical due to limited direct connections and longer overall travel times when considering airport transfers. For efficiency and comfort, the train is highly recommended, especially for first-time visitors or those without a car.
